  • @TanieBaker
    @TanieBaker 6 месяцев назад +20

    In the book, Mister simply said that Nettie had to go cause she wouldn’t give it up. There was no drama at all. She packed her bags and left. The attempted sexual assault didn’t occur until after she moved out in route to school in the woods if I recall.

  • @SanFranDentist94301
    @SanFranDentist94301 6 месяцев назад

    Nettie and Mister. In the book Nettie is mildly interested in Mister______. Hes distinguished, older, and rich. Thats why Mister asked Alphonso to marry her, they had been making eyes at each other.
    One of the problems with Mister was that his wife wasn't long dead and she had been murdered by HER lover coming home from church.
    Also of note Mister loves dark skin women with long hair. Celie had the skin but not the hair. Nettie had both. And so did his furst wife and Shug.
